Author:  marciblue [ Sun Jul 08, 2012 9:21 am ]
Post subject:  Re: Makes me angry

The thing that annoys me with the Jacobs trade is that the club wasn't brave enough to realise that it already had three bonafide rucks on our list before it started chasing Warnock. If it had been diligent, this assessment would have been fairly obvious at the time IMO and the club shouldn't have bothered chasing Robbie for what has proven to be an inflated price.

Looking back, we overpayed for Warnock and really his output has not justified the effort and cost we put in acquiring him. We ended up losing a young ruck who has now elevated himself into one of the league's best and overtaken the guy we spent so much to acquire. And to think he now looks like packing up and moving on is even more irritating.

AFAIC, another case of poor list management and the chance to acquire some more young talent with the 2nd round pick we relinquished is an opportunity lost
